Summary: | Catch figures of different demersal species(cod, haddock, saithe etc.) in the cod-ends of a two level trawl were examined using variable height of the separating panel (0.5, 0.75, 1.0 and 1.5 m). Cod enters the trawl mainly in the lower part of trawl while haddock, and especially saithe, enter the trawl at higher levels. Diurnal and size dependant effects were recorded. |
